Couples & Co.

Champion golfer Fred Couples and award-winning winemaker Mitch Cosentino have teamed up to form Couples & Co, a wine brand that celebrates a shared Italian heritage and fine, limited-production wine. After an in-depth tasting of preliminary blends with Cosentino in 2008, Couples knew he had found the right partner. “We are producing limited production wines designed to accompany fine world cuisine. But wine that also works artistically and stands on its own.” Mitch Cosentino
| Wine | Couples & Co 2006 California Sangiovese |
| Appellation | California (60% Napa Valley, 40% Lodi) |
| Composition | 82% Sangiovese, 18% Bordeaux varietals |
| Winemaking | Partially punch cap fermented in open tanks, followed by more than two years of oak aging |
| Production | 1050 cases |

| Couples & Co 2006 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on | Intense and rich with great depth that shows balance and length. From some of the most acclaimed grape growers in the Napa Valley |
| Appellation | Napa Valley (60% St. Helena, 25% Oakville) |
| Composition | 85% CS, 8% Merlot, 5% Cabernet Franc, 2% Malbec |
| Winemaking | Partially punch cap fermented for between 7 and 11 days. Small lots were tank fermented. Barrel aged separately in French oak for 30 months. Selected, racked and blended before bottling, unfined. |
| Production | 525 cases |
